Description
Two half-discs are hinged on a central pin and held closed by torsion springs. Forward flow folds them open into the bore; as the flow decays the springs shut them, so the valve closes on falling flow rather than on reverse flow. The face-to-face length is a fraction of a flanged swing check of the same bore, which is why the wafer pattern is used where pipe runs are tight or valve weight matters.
On the unit photographed the plates, hinge pin, stop pin and springs are stainless: both plates are cast CF8M, the ASTM A351 grade equivalent to AISI 316. The body is a painted casting and carries no material mark, so the body metal — cast iron, ductile iron or carbon steel — must be stated on the order rather than assumed from the photograph. Where the body is cast iron, the governing European standard is EN 16767, metallic check valves, which replaced the withdrawn EN 12334 in 2016; for cast iron flanged and wafer bodies it covers PN 2,5 to PN 25 and Class 125 and Class 250.
Order by nominal size, body material, seat material and — because the valve is clamped between two flanges — the flange standard and rating. ASME B16.5 Class 150/300 and EN 1092-1 PN 10/16/25/40 are drilled differently and will not substitute for one another.
